PS S, born: 01/25, male dog. At Finca since 10/25. A few weeks ago, Sarah and Sven stumbled upon four wild and extremely shy young puppies in a nearby Barroco while on their Finca. The small ones apparently lived in caves under a large stone pile. The two quickly set up water and food spots and continued to visit them daily, filling them up but also spending as much time as possible there. The puppies should get used to them and gain trust. The smallest, already very worn-out Miyu, became very friendly very quickly and was brought to the Finca as the first one in safety. In the following weeks, as soon as the other siblings heard Sarah and Sven, they came running frantically, but it took a long time for their trust to solidify enough for them to allow themselves to go to the Finca. But with much patience, Sarah and Sven managed to bring the small male dogs, now named Maximio, and the small female, now named Manita, to the Finca without stress and fear. Manita and Maximio now occupy a large enclosure in their new home, a bit apart to settle in quietly. The first few days were very tiring for them, and they slept a lot. It seemed like a big change for the siblings, no longer having to hunt for food and fight daily for survival. They now have a roof over their heads and a cozy warm blanket to sleep in. Although they no longer lived in freedom, they took their new happiness well and quickly adapted to their new surroundings. The bond with their new humans is becoming more and more trusting and closer. They are wild with joy when Sarah and Sven come, enjoying their petting sessions and demanding to play. Maximio loves to lie on his back and have his belly rubbed. After some time, it became clear that the two furred children now also play with each other. Probably they didn’t do this in the wild, as they had other priorities, fighting for survival. Now they play daily and have even come to like toys. They whirl and frolic wildly and exuberantly, of course, young puppies sometimes get a bit wild and rambunctious. Maximio is a little more reserved than his sister. New situations are still a bit eerie for him, but he lets everything happen and participates. He often runs after his sister, especially when she discovers something. He also watches and barks when there’s something to bark about, but his interest quickly wanes. He has already had his first visit to the vet and handled it very well. All examinations were done calmly, even the blood draw was tolerated without resistance. The vet who knew the boy’s history was completely charmed, he let her pet him. The car ride went smoothly in the transport box. Still, everything new is a bit eerie and needs to be practiced. This includes wearing a harness and walking on a leash. These are, however, small hurdles that can be mastered with much love and patience and will become routine. Now, the little puppy boy is looking for his own family with a soft, cozy basket, showing him a lot of the world and giving him security and love. 🇩🇪Adopting from Germany

German rescues typically require an in-person home visit (Vorkontrolle) or detailed video home check before approving adoption. Animals leave the shelter sterilized, microchipped, and with a valid EU pet passport. Adoption fees usually fall between €250 and €450, covering veterinary preparation.

Can I adopt Maximo (CBS) if I live in another country?
Yes, in most cases. Rescues across Europe routinely place animals abroad — Tierhilfe Fuerteventura will tell you what they need (EU pet passport, rabies titer, transport coordination) and whether they handle transport themselves or refer you to a partner. Plan for an extra €100–€350 in transport costs depending on distance.
